One of the main
reasons why people purchase laptop computers is because they are portable and
able to be used pretty much anywhere. There is only one small problem with this
idea, at some point you will need to be near the mains to charge up the
battery. If you’re nowhere near the mains or have forgotten your charger then
you then every minute counts until your laptop battery eventually runs out. Below
are just a few pieces of advice when trying to preserve the life of your
battery.
Drain the battery regularly
Your battery can
suffer from capacity degradation and, if constantly left on charge, the battery
doesn’t realise the limit of what it is capable of. By running the battery
completely flat once every month and then recharging the battery to the max,
this will hopefully help the battery last a lot longer.
Batteries hate the heat
In general,
laptops don’t really like extremely hot conditions as it makes the internal fan
work overtime to try and cool the components, which obviously has an effect on
the battery life. Hot conditions are also terrible for the battery itself as it
can really degrade the battery rapidly.
Keep the battery in
Taking the
battery out regularly is never a good idea as it can add to the wear and tear
on the computer and attract more dirt onto the battery and inside the battery
compartment. This can lead to further battery corrosion amongst other problems.
Turn the light down
The brightness of
a laptop screen can really drain the battery, especially as computer screens
are getting more powerful and brighter. By reducing the brightness of the
screen when your battery is running out quickly will help preserve the battery
life for a little longer.
